What You Should Know About a Four Wheel Electric Scooter

A four-wheel electric scooter is an excellent way to get around. They provide stability and can support a large amount of weight. They have powerful motors and long battery lives. Medicare often covers these devices, but only after the doctor has examined you face-to-face.

Four-wheel scooters are a great option for those who require more stability and durability than three-wheel models. They can withstand rough terrain and travel further on a single battery charge than other scooters. However they have a bigger turning radius and are less maneuverable in tight spaces. They are intended for outdoor use, but can also be used indoors. These scooters are equipped with features that shield them from the elements. They can also be disassembled to transport.

The canopy protects against extreme weather conditions and is a feature that many people appreciate. This is essential for those who spend a lot of time outside and want to limit their exposure to harmful ultraviolet rays. This feature can help maintain an enjoyable riding experience by limiting direct sunlight exposure.

A four-wheeled scooter can also be used on rougher surfaces like dirt, gravel and grass. This is especially useful for those who live in rural areas and have access to natural trails and paths. Some scooters come with suspension, which helps them to be more stable on uneven terrain.

Design

Four-wheel mobility scooters are engineered to offer more stability than 3-wheel models. This makes them the perfect option for those who need an extra hand in to navigate rough terrains and slopes. These scooters can also be used to travel over longer distances, as they are able to travel up to 45 miles on one charge.

The basic structure of the four-wheeled scooter resembles to the car. Two wheels control the motion at the back, while two wheels control the scooter from the front. This provides a greater degree of stability and allows it to maneuver over curbs and small lengths of dirt or grass. It also allows for more legroom than a model with three wheels, making it more comfortable for taller individuals and those with leg and knee injuries.

It is essential to consider your budget and requirements when choosing a four wheel scooter. You will need to determine the kind of terrain you'll be using the scooter for, and what type of speed you're looking for. You might also want to consider how much space you will require for storage and other accessories. Once you've determined your requirements, it's time to select the right scooter for your lifestyle.

Weight capacity

The capacity to carry the weight of a four wheel electric scooter is a key aspect to take into account, because it will determine how far you can travel on a single charge. This is the maximum amount of weight that can be carried by the scooter without causing damage, including the driver's own weight and any bags or shopping that you carry on board. You can use a calculator to find how much the mobility scooter can hold by beginning with your weight, and then adding any passengers and cargo you'll be carrying on board.

Mobility scooters with four wheels offer more stability than those with three wheels. They are also designed to handle more weight and navigate uneven surfaces. They also have a wider base and are less likely to tip over, even when driving at high speeds. They are therefore perfect for those who require an elevated platform to move across rough terrain like grass, gravel and inclines.

Designed like cars, four-wheel scooters feature two wheels that move from the back and two wheels for steering in the front. This improves stability and allows mobility scooters to carry more weight. They are particularly suited for use in the outdoors, where they can easily navigate rough terrains, such as gravel roads and hills.

Battery life

The battery of the electric scooter is an important element of any motorized mobility device. It is the source of power to turn the wheels. The lifespan of a battery is affected by many factors, including the frequency at the battery is used, its maintenance and storage location. If a battery is not taken care of properly, it can quickly lose capacity and power.

The majority of mobility scooters are powered by lithium-ion batteries, which is the same type of battery that you'll find in your smartphone or laptop. These batteries can provide high energy performance due to their greater energy density. Li-ion batteries function by separating two electrodes using an electrolyte. The scooter's motor is powered by the electricity generated by lithium ions that are pushed from the anode by the electrolyte. The battery is charged when the scooter's charger is plugged in, but it is important to know the number of cycles it can undergo before losing its charging capacity.

A quality scooter will last an hour when fully charged battery charge. However the exact duration will vary based on the model and other factors. In general, batteries are designed to last for 300 to 500 charge-discharge cycles, however, this can differ depending on the manufacturer. Safety

Be aware of safety features while riding on a four-wheel electric scooter. This includes good brakes and sturdy frames that can take the punishment of bumps. A quality scooter should have bright headlights and tail lights to provide better visibility. It also has an alarm that can be heard, which can be either an electronic or mechanical ring. This is a courteous method to ensure that other riders hear your message.

Electric scooters are a great option to get through the city, but they require special precautions for safety. Helmets, elbow and knee protection are crucial. Don't use your mobile while riding. By doing this, you will be able to safeguard you from serious injuries in the event of an accident. Moreover, you should never use an electric scooter when drunk, particularly after drinking. This is the leading cause of scooter accidents in large cities where people go bar-hopping on shared scooters.

A good scooter comes with a braking mechanism that is easy to use even at high speed. It should have a wide range of brakes, including anti-lock brakes. It should also have a wide tire and a solid base to limit the possibility of sliding or slipping.

It's also essential to know the sidewalk or road surface. A smaller wheel requires the rider to be aware of things like potholes and loose gravel which could easily frighten them. Keep a safe distance from pedestrians as they may not be able to see you. This is the reason you should always travel at a lower speed in urban areas.
